| | | Techniques to Reduce & Replace Pesticides | Biocontrol & Cultural Techniques |
| Walnuts & Pome Fruit | Pheromone-based pest (codling moth) traps; agroecological monitoring protocols; assess beneficial insects | Pheromone mating disruption; foster biocontrol by eliminating OPs from orchard; precise timing of pesticide applications; reduced rates of application | Orchard sanitation; beneficial insect releases; bird/bat boxes; |
| Grapes (wine, table & raisin) | Agroecological monitoring protocols; assess beneficial insects; insect ID sheets; computer monitoring data software | Decision rules and treatment thresholds; softer pesticides; precise timing of pesticide applications; reduced rates of application | Leaf pulling; beneficial insect releases; cover crops to moderate vigor |
| Almonds & Stone Fruit | Agroecological monitoring protocols; pheromone-based traps; assess beneficial insects; insect ID sheets; computer monitoring data software; | Develop specific economic thresholds; pesticide use decision rules; softer pesticides (Bt, pheromones, ant baits); precise timing of pesticide applications; reduced rates of application | Early harvest; orchard sanitation; beneficial insect releases; cover crops |
| Citrus | Agroecological monitoring protocols; assess beneficial insects | Ecologically selective pesticides | Beneficial insect releases; irrigation management |
| Annual Crops | Agroecological monitoring protocols; assess beneficial insects | Avoiding early season pesticide application; softer pesticides | Insectary crops; releasing beneficials; optimizing plant nutrition; resistant varietals; trap crops |
